Global crude oil is expected to have more than 1.5 million barrels of excess daily production next year, and oil prices will continue to fall

global crude oil is expected to have more than 1.5 million barrels of excess daily production next year, and oil prices will continue to fall

December 09, 2014

[China paint information] Harry tchilinguirian, chief commodity futures market strategist of BNP Paribas, pointed out on Monday (December 8), Even after considering various extreme conditions that may lead to a reduction in crude oil supply or an increase in demand, the bank's prediction model still shows that there will be a surplus of 1.5 million to 2million barrels between international crude oil supply and demand in the first half of next year, which is expected to put further pressure on international oil prices

analysts believe that under the background that the organization of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) decided to maintain output unchanged at the end of last month, the contradiction of oversupply in the oil market will be further sharpened and highlighted for most of next year, so it is inevitable that oil prices will continue to be under pressure.
